Abstract:Cerebrovascular disorder-induced brain blood flow interruption or intracranial hemorrhage pose a great threaten to health. Emerging roles of long-noncoding RNAs (lncRNAs) in diagnosis and treatment of cardiovascular diseases have been recognized. However, whether and how lncRNAs modulate vascular homeostasis, especially network formation remain largely unknown.
